org.seasar.junitcdi.easymock.internal
クラス ClassExtensionEacyMockDelegator

java.lang.Object
  上位を拡張 org.seasar.junitcdi.easymock.internal.ClassExtensionEacyMockDelegator
すべての実装されたインタフェース:
EasyMockDelegator

public class ClassExtensionEacyMockDelegator
extends Object
implements EasyMockDelegator

EasyMock Class ExtensionのEasyMockに委譲するEasyMockDelegatorの実装クラスです.

作成者:
koichik

コンストラクタの概要
ClassExtensionEacyMockDelegator()
           
 
メソッドの概要
<T> T
createMock(Class<T> clazz)
          モックを作成して返します.
<T> T
createNiceMock(Class<T> clazz)
          Niceモックを作成して返します.
<T> T
createStrictMock(Class<T> clazz)
          Strictモックを作成して返します.
 void replay(Object... mocks)
          モックをreplayモードに設定します.
 void reset(Object... mocks)
          モックをリセットします.
 void verify(Object... mocks)
          モックとのインタラクションを検証します.
 
クラス java.lang.Object から継承されたメソッド
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

コンストラクタの詳細

ClassExtensionEacyMockDelegator

public ClassExtensionEacyMockDelegator()
メソッドの詳細

createMock

public <T> T createMock(Class<T> clazz)
インタフェース EasyMockDelegator の記述:
モックを作成して返します.

定義:
インタフェース EasyMockDelegator 内の createMock
型パラメータ:
T - 作成するモックの型
パラメータ:
clazz - 作成するモックの型
戻り値:
作成されたモック

createNiceMock

public <T> T createNiceMock(Class<T> clazz)
インタフェース EasyMockDelegator の記述:
Niceモックを作成して返します.

定義:
インタフェース EasyMockDelegator 内の createNiceMock
型パラメータ:
T - 作成するモックの型
パラメータ:
clazz - 作成するモックの型
戻り値:
作成されたモック

createStrictMock

public <T> T createStrictMock(Class<T> clazz)
インタフェース EasyMockDelegator の記述:
Strictモックを作成して返します.

定義:
インタフェース EasyMockDelegator 内の createStrictMock
型パラメータ:
T - 作成するモックの型
パラメータ:
clazz - 作成するモックの型
戻り値:
作成されたモック

replay

public void replay(Object... mocks)
インタフェース EasyMockDelegator の記述:
モックをreplayモードに設定します.

定義:
インタフェース EasyMockDelegator 内の replay
パラメータ:
mocks - モックの配列

reset

public void reset(Object... mocks)
インタフェース EasyMockDelegator の記述:
モックをリセットします.

定義:
インタフェース EasyMockDelegator 内の reset
パラメータ:
mocks - モックの配列

verify

public void verify(Object... mocks)
インタフェース EasyMockDelegator の記述:
モックとのインタラクションを検証します.

定義:
インタフェース EasyMockDelegator 内の verify
パラメータ:
mocks - モックの配列


Copyright © 2010 The Seasar Foundation. All Rights Reserved.